### Migration Guide — Step 4: Repoint RestockPilot to the new planner core

Before support can close migration tickets, confirm each operator's RestockPilot instance has been repointed from the retired scheduling core to the new planner. Failing to do so leaves machines on stale route plans, which surfaces as "no restock window" errors in the operator console. Walk the customer through restarting the agent after the switch, then verify the planner handshake completes. Once repointed, the instance should report the following configuration.

service settings:
BRIATH_LOG_LEVEL=warn
BRIATH_METRICS_HOST=metrics.briath.zemvarsys.internal
BRIATH_POOL_SIZE=16

On-call: the Pointstack loyalty ledger reconciles nightly at 02:00. If balances drift, check the Meridly sync worker first — it retries silently. Ledger writes require the signing credential rotated by the Velmora platform team each quarter. Do not restart the worker without it loaded. Add the following line to the ledger's .env before restarting:

vault entry, yahaf-tagug: LEDGER_TOKEN20=884d77d1a8b98aa4edfb

Ticket: SIDE-412 — Metrics sidecar config drift on Orvale cluster

The metrics-aggregation sidecar (Tallyhound) on the Orvale cluster has drifted from the baseline committed last month. Flush intervals and label filters differ across four nodes, producing inconsistent dashboards. We should re-converge before Thursday's deploy. To aid the discussion at the sync, the configuration currently running on the affected nodes is reproduced below.

deployment values, bahof-badug:
[rusix]
team = zorok
access_code = ac_641cbe
owner = ulair.tamius
host = rusix.torvasoft.local
port = 5672
peer = ulaix.sivrelworks.internal
salt = 1df570ed
pin = 6327

**14:22 — Dedup job paused.** During the Merrivale customer-record deduplication run, the matcher began collapsing distinct households sharing a surname and postal zone. Tomas halted the pipeline before the merge committed, preserving the staging snapshot. We confirmed 312 candidate pairs were affected, none written to the primary store. Root cause traces to a weighting change in the fuzzy-match scorer deployed that morning. The exact build that introduced the change is recorded below.

trace token, fafog-kageg: htk4_98e6